Why Hispanics Pay More for Utilities
Hispanic families in the United States face particular challenges when it comes to utilities. Many live in older rental homes with lower energy efficiency. According to the U.S. Department of Energy, homes built before 1980 consume up to 30 percent more energy than modern constructions.
Additionally, Hispanic households tend to be multigenerational, with an average of 3.5 people per household compared to the national average of 2.5. This means more water usage, more laundry, more time with lights on, and greater overall consumption. However, these characteristics do not condemn you to permanently high bills.
Free Energy Audit: Your First Step
Before spending a single dollar on improvements, request a free energy audit. Most electric companies in the United States offer this service at no cost, especially if your income qualifies for assistance programs. During the audit, a certified technician visits your home and identifies exactly where energy is being wasted.
The technician will use a thermal camera to detect air leaks, check your attic insulation, inspect your appliances, and examine your heating and cooling systems. At the end, you will receive a detailed report with prioritized recommendations based on return on investment. Many families find they are losing between $100 and $300 annually simply due to a poorly sealed door or an inefficient water heater.
To find free audits in your area, visit the official website of the Department of Energy at https://www.energy.gov or contact your electric company directly. Some utilities even install basic improvements like weather stripping and low-flow showerheads during the same visit at no additional charge.
The LIHEAP Program Directly Reduces Your Bills
The Low-Income Home Energy Assistance Program (LIHEAP) is one of the most underutilized resources by the Hispanic community. This federal program helps pay electricity, gas, heating oil, and other home energy costs. Approximately 40 percent of eligible families never apply for these benefits simply because they are unaware of their existence.
LIHEAP can cover between $200 and $1,500 annually depending on the state you live in, the size of your family, and your income. For example, in Texas, a family of four with an income of up to $54,000 annually may qualify. In California, the limits are even more generous. The program not only helps with regular bills but also in emergencies when you face a service cut-off.
To apply, contact the local community action agency in your county or visit the official government benefits site at https://www.benefits.gov. You will need proof of income, recent utility bills, and proof of residence. Many Hispanic community organizations offer free assistance to complete the application.
Thermostat Adjustments That Generate Real Savings
The thermostat is the device that has the most impact on your electric bill. It controls between 40 and 50 percent of your total energy consumption. The good news is that small adjustments can generate significant savings without noticeably affecting your comfort. The Department of Energy confirms that every degree of difference in your thermostat can represent between 1 and 3 percent savings on your bill.
During the summer, set your thermostat to 78 degrees Fahrenheit when you are home and active. When you sleep, raise it to 82 degrees; your body tolerates higher temperatures better while resting under light sheets. If you leave home for more than four hours, set it to 85 degrees. These adjustments can reduce your summer bill by between $80 and $150 monthly in states like Arizona, Texas, or Florida.
In winter, keep the thermostat at 68 degrees during the day and lower it to 62-65 degrees at night. Use extra blankets instead of heating the entire house. A $30 thermal blanket provides the same comfort as keeping the temperature 5 degrees higher, saving you approximately $120 during the cold season.
Smart Thermostats with Discounts and Rebates
Smart thermostats learn your living patterns and automatically adjust the temperature to maximize savings without sacrificing comfort. Brands like Nest, Ecobee, and Honeywell Home cost between $120 and $250, but electric companies often offer rebates of $50 to $100, reducing the actual cost to less than $100.
A smart thermostat can reduce your heating and cooling costs by between 10 and 23 percent annually, according to independent studies. For a family that spends $200 monthly on electricity, this represents savings of $240 to $552 annually. The device pays for itself in about six months.
Many models connect with voice assistants like Alexa or Google Home, allowing you to adjust the temperature without getting off the couch. You can also control them from your phone when you are away from home. If you forgot to adjust the thermostat before leaving for work, you can do it from the app and avoid cooling or heating an empty house for eight hours.
LED Lighting: The Most Profitable Investment
Replacing traditional incandescent bulbs with LEDs is probably the energy efficiency improvement with the best return on investment available. A 60-watt equivalent LED bulb costs between $2 and $5 and uses 75 percent less electricity than an incandescent bulb. Additionally, it lasts between 15 and 25 times longer, eliminating the cost and hassle of frequent replacements.
If your home has 30 bulbs and you use them an average of five hours daily, switching all to LED can save you between $180 and $240 annually. The initial investment of $60 to $150 is recouped in less than a year. After that, it's pure savings for the next 10 to 15 years of the bulbs' lifespan.
Modern LED bulbs are available in multiple light tones. Look for "warm white" (2700K-3000K) for living rooms and bedrooms if you prefer a cozier light similar to incandescent. For kitchens, bathrooms, and work areas, "bright white" (3500K-4100K) provides better visibility. Many hardware stores offer discounted multipurpose packs that include different types.
Efficient Appliances: When It’s Worth Replacing Them
Not all old appliances need immediate replacement, but some consume so much energy that replacing them generates substantial savings. Refrigerators, washing machines, and water heaters are the three main energy consumers in most Hispanic households.
A refrigerator made before 2000 consumes approximately twice as much electricity as a modern Energy Star model. If your refrigerator is over 15 years old and your electric bill is high, replacing it can save you between $100 and $200 annually. Mid-sized Energy Star models cost between $600 and $1,200, but many states and electric companies offer rebates of $50 to $200.
Energy Star front-loading washers use 40 percent less water and 25 percent less electricity than traditional top-loading ones. For a family that does six loads weekly, this represents savings of $40 to $60 annually just in electricity, plus another $30 to $50 in water. If you also use cold water for most loads, the savings double.
Water Heaters: The Hidden Source of Waste
The water heater accounts for approximately 18 percent of your total energy consumption, being the second largest consumer after the heating and cooling system. Most families keep the heater temperature too high and lose energy constantly due to inadequately insulated tanks.
Lower your water heater temperature to 120 degrees Fahrenheit. The factory setting is usually 140 degrees, much more than necessary and potentially dangerous for small children. This simple reduction can decrease your water heating costs by between 6 and 10 percent, saving you $20 to $40 annually.
Wrap your hot water tank with an insulating blanket, especially if it is located in a garage, basement, or unheated space. These blankets cost between $20 and $40 at hardware stores and can reduce heat loss in standby mode by up to 45 percent. Also, insulate the first six feet of hot water pipe coming from the tank using pipe insulation foam that costs less than $10.
Rebate Programs for Efficient Water Heaters
If your water heater is over 10 years old, it may be time to consider a replacement. Modern models are significantly more efficient, and rebate programs can cover much of the cost. Tankless water heaters are extremely efficient because they only heat water when you need it, eliminating standby losses.
A tankless heater costs between $800 and $1,500 installed, but it can reduce your water heating costs by between 24 and 34 percent compared to a traditional tank. For an average family, this represents savings of $80 to $150 annually. Many gas and electric companies offer rebates of $300 to $500 for the installation of tankless heaters, significantly reducing the initial cost.
Heat pump water heaters are another extremely efficient option, using electricity to move heat from the air to the water instead of generating it directly. They are two to three times more efficient than traditional electric heaters and qualify for federal and state rebates of up to $700 in some cases.
Sealing Air Leaks: The Invisible Problem
Air leaks around doors, windows, ducts, and other openings can increase your heating and cooling costs by 10 to 30 percent. The air conditioning or heating that you pay for literally escapes through the cracks while outside air enters uncontrollably. The good news is that sealing these leaks is one of the most cost-effective improvement projects with the best return.
Adhesive weatherstripping for doors and windows costs between $5 and $15 per roll and is extremely easy to install. Simply measure, cut, and stick. Focus first on exterior doors, especially those leading to the garage or basement. Then check the windows you use frequently. An investment of $50 in weatherstripping can save you $100 to $200 annually.
Caulking around window frames, pipes that pass through walls, and other small spaces prevents additional infiltration. A tube of silicone caulk costs between $3 and $6 and is enough to seal multiple windows. Look for cracks where different materials meet: brick with wood, concrete with vinyl, or where wires and pipes enter your home.
Windows and Curtains: Affordable Thermal Barriers
Replacing old windows with double-pane, low-emissivity models is effective but costly, with prices ranging from $400 to $800 per installed window. Fortunately, there are much more affordable alternatives that provide substantial benefits without the larger investment. Thermal curtains and blinds create an insulating barrier that keeps air conditioning inside during the summer and heat inside during the winter.
Good quality thermal curtains cost between $20 and $50 per panel and can reduce heat loss through windows by up to 25 percent. During the summer, keeping them closed during the hottest hours of the day can reduce solar heat gain by up to 33 percent. For a home with eight windows, an investment of $200 to $300 in thermal curtains can generate savings of $100 to $180 annually.
Reflective window film is another economical option, especially effective in warm climates. These films reject up to 80 percent of solar heat while allowing light to pass through. Complete DIY application kits cost between $30 and $60 for standard windows and can reduce your air conditioning costs by 5 to 15 percent during the summer months.
Strategic Use of Fans to Reduce Air Conditioning
Ceiling and floor fans use a fraction of the electricity that air conditioning consumes, but they allow you to feel comfortable at higher temperatures. A ceiling fan uses about 75 watts compared to 3,500 watts for a central air conditioning system. Using fans strategically can raise your thermostat by 4 degrees without sacrificing comfort, saving you between 12 and 15 percent on cooling costs.
The key is to use fans correctly. Fans cool people, not rooms, by creating a breeze that evaporates moisture from your skin. Therefore, turn them off when you leave a room. During the summer, ceiling fans should spin counterclockwise to push air down. Most have a small switch on the base of the motor to change direction.
Floor or tower fans are great for cooling specific areas where you spend more time. A good quality tower fan costs between $30 and $60 and can allow you to turn off air conditioning completely during cooler mornings and afternoons, saving you $40 to $80 monthly during the summer in moderate climate states.
HVAC System Maintenance: Prevention That Saves Money
Regular maintenance of your heating, ventilation, and air conditioning (HVAC) system is crucial for maintaining efficiency and preventing costly repairs. A neglected system can consume up to 20 percent more energy than a well-maintained one. The best part is that many basic maintenance tasks can be done by yourself without hiring a technician.
Changing air filters every one to three months is the most important task. Dirty filters restrict airflow, forcing the system to work harder and consume more electricity. Basic filters cost between $10 and $20 for a pack of three. If you have pets or allergies, change it every month. In homes without pets, every two or three months is sufficient.
Clean the vent grilles and ensure they are not blocked by furniture, curtains, or toys. Air must circulate freely for the system to operate efficiently. Once a year, vacuum the air return grilles to remove accumulated dust. Keep the area around your outdoor unit clear by removing leaves, branches, and weeds that may obstruct airflow.
Professional HVAC Service: When It's Worth the Investment
While you can handle basic maintenance yourself, an annual professional service is a smart investment. A certified technician checks refrigerant levels, cleans coils, inspects electrical connections, and ensures the system operates at maximum efficiency. This service costs between $75 and $150 but can prevent repairs costing $500 to $2,000 and keep your energy costs under control.
Many HVAC companies offer annual maintenance contracts that include two visits (spring and fall) for $150 to $250. These contracts typically include discounts on repairs and priority for emergency calls. If your system is over five years old, a maintenance contract provides peace of mind and long-term savings.
Schedule the service in spring before the air conditioning season and in fall before winter. A tuned system operates 10 to 15 percent more efficiently, saving you $120 to $200 annually on energy bills. Additionally, a well-maintained system lasts three to five years longer than a neglected one, postponing the $3,000 to $7,000 investment of a complete replacement.
Appliances in Standby Mode: Energy Vampires
Electronic devices and appliances in standby mode continuously consume electricity even when you are not actively using them. This phantom consumption accounts for 5 to 10 percent of your residential electric bill, costing the average family between $100 and $200 annually according to the Department of Energy.
The main culprits include televisions, gaming consoles, computers, phone chargers, microwaves, coffee makers, and any device with a digital clock or LED light. A modern television can consume between 5 and 20 watts in standby mode. If you have three televisions, this represents $30 to $40 annually just for keeping them plugged in.
The simplest solution is to use power strips with switches. Plug multiple devices into a power strip and turn it off completely when not in use. For example, connect your TV, streaming player, gaming console, and sound system to a single power strip. When you finish watching TV, turn off the power strip. Basic power strips cost between $10 and $20, and programmable smart strips range from $25 to $40.
Smart Power Strips That Automatically Shut Off
Smart power strips take control of energy vampires to the next level by automatically shutting off peripheral devices when you turn off the main device. For example, when you turn off your TV, the smart power strip detects the drop in consumption and automatically cuts power to your Blu-ray player, sound system, and gaming console.
These strips cost between $25 and $50 but can save you $75 to $150 annually depending on how many devices you have. Advanced models include programmable timers, allowing you to automatically turn off equipment at specific times. This is especially useful for entertainment equipment that kids forget to turn off or for home office spaces.
Smart power strips with WiFi can be controlled from your phone, and some work with voice assistants. You can create routines to automatically turn off all entertainment at 11 PM or check from work if you forgot to turn off the iron. This technology provides both energy savings and peace of mind.
Efficient Laundry: Cold Water and Full Loads
The washing machine consumes energy in two ways: the motor that agitates the clothes and the heating of the water. Approximately 90 percent of the energy your washing machine uses goes to heating the water. Switching from hot to cold water can reduce energy consumption per load by up to 90 percent, saving an average family between $60 and $100 annually.
Modern detergents are formulated to work effectively in cold water. Brands like Tide, Persil, and Arm & Hammer have specific versions for cold water that clean as well as hot water for most loads. Reserve hot water only for very dirty clothes, towels, and bedding, reducing your hot water use by about 75 percent.
Wash only full loads to maximize the efficiency of each cycle. A full load uses approximately the same amount of water and energy as a medium load, so waiting to have enough clothes reduces the total number of washes. If you absolutely need to wash a small load, adjust the water level accordingly; many modern washers do this automatically.
Efficient Drying and Natural Alternatives
The dryer is one of the most energy-consuming appliances in the home, costing approximately $100 to $150 annually in electricity for an average family. Reducing its use or making it operate more efficiently can generate significant savings without much sacrifice.
Clean the lint filter after every load. A clogged filter reduces airflow and can double drying time, wasting electricity and money. Also, check the dryer’s exterior vent quarterly to ensure it is not blocked by accumulated lint. A blocked vent not only wastes energy but also poses a fire hazard.
Use the automatic moisture sensor if your dryer has one, instead of set timers. The sensor stops the dryer as soon as the clothes are dry, preventing over-drying that wastes energy and damages fabrics. Separate loads by weight and fabric type; drying thick towels and t-shirts together makes the dryer work inefficiently.
During warm weather, consider using an outdoor clothesline or an indoor drying rack. Air-drying two or three loads a week for six months can save you $40 to $70. Foldable drying racks cost between $20 and $40 and last for years.
Efficient Cooking: Small Changes, Big Savings
The kitchen offers numerous opportunities to reduce energy consumption without changing what you cook or how you eat. Using the appropriate appliance for each task makes a big difference. A toaster oven or air fryer uses approximately 50 percent less electricity than a conventional oven for small portions.
When using the stove, make sure the size of the pot matches the burner. A small pot on a large burner wastes up to 40 percent of the heat. Use lids while cooking; water boils faster and food cooks quicker, reducing the time the burners are on. This simple habit can cut cooking energy consumption by up to 65 percent.
The microwave is extremely efficient for reheating leftovers and cooking small portions, using about 50 percent less energy than the oven. A slow cooker consumes less electricity than the oven and is ideal for traditional Hispanic meals like beans, stews, and braised meats. It uses only between 150 and 300 watts compared to 2,000 to 5,000 watts for the oven.
Refrigerator: Optimization and Maintenance
Your refrigerator runs 24 hours a day, 365 days a year, accounting for about 13 percent of your total electricity consumption. Keeping it running efficiently and using it correctly can lead to substantial savings. The ideal temperature for the refrigeration compartment is between 35 and 38 degrees Fahrenheit, and the freezer should be at 0 degrees.
Lower temperatures waste electricity without providing additional preservation benefits. Use an inexpensive refrigerator thermometer ($5 to $10) to check that your refrigerator is properly set. Each degree below the optimal temperature increases energy consumption by about 5 percent.
Clean the condenser coils (located at the back or bottom) twice a year using a vacuum with a brush attachment. Dust-covered coils make the refrigerator work harder to dissipate heat, increasing consumption by up to 25 percent. Check the door seals; if you can slide a closed bill between the seal and the refrigerator and it comes out easily, you need to replace the seal.
Keep the refrigerator reasonably full but not overloaded. A full refrigerator retains cold better when you open the door, but it needs space for air to circulate. If your refrigerator is frequently half-empty, fill water bottles to take up space and improve efficiency.
Average Billing: Stabilize Your Monthly Payments
Many electric companies offer average or levelized billing programs that calculate your annual consumption and divide the cost into 12 equal monthly payments. This does not reduce your total bill, but it eliminates seasonal fluctuations that can affect your monthly budget. It is especially helpful for Hispanic families who need to plan expenses accurately.
For example, if your bill averages $150 annually but varies between $80 in spring and $280 in the height of summer, levelized billing sets a fixed monthly payment of $150. You pay more in cooler months but much less in hot months, making family budgeting easier. Most companies adjust the average annually based on your actual consumption.
This program works best if your income is stable and you prefer certainty over variability. It is not recommended if your income fluctuates seasonally, as you might struggle to pay $150 in months when you would normally pay $80. Contact your electric company to find out if they offer average billing and what the enrollment requirements are.
Utility Payment Assistance Programs
In addition to LIHEAP, there are other programs that help with utility payments. Many electric and gas companies have their own assistance programs for low-income customers that offer monthly discounts, flexible payment plans, and protection against service disconnections. These programs are often not widely advertised, so you should call and ask specifically.
For example, Southern California Edison offers the CARE (California Alternate Rates for Energy) program, which provides discounts of 30 to 35 percent on electric rates for qualifying families. PG&E has similar programs. In Texas, several providers offer the Lite-Up Texas program with discounts of 10 to 20 percent. Florida Power & Light has the CARE program that reduces monthly rates.
Eligibility requirements vary by state and company, but are generally based on income and household size.
